What's the default music provider set on your Google Home? When did it start happening? Also, were there any recent changes to your network or set up? 

 

Give these steps a whirl:

 

  1. Try relinking your music provider from the Google Home app.
  2. Reinstall your Google Home app.
  3. Reboot your Google Home and router to refresh the connection.
